can can benefit from the code uh anyway back to the vid so for a macro perspective there's really
four outcomes four potential outcomes with this reic situation right the first is that the New
York Jets and Hasan reic come to some sort of agreement and there's a solution reic shows up
reic is playing the Jets want him there he be he comes in and helps out a room that uh again
based off of week one we we we we could use the help uh sweet right awesome option number two reic
holds out but the Jets end up finding a solution along the way weeks from now a month from now
month and a half from now and at that point you know yeah reic does help the team but
what's our record at that point reck still has not you know he I mean like it's tough to
imagine somebody showing up in like like around Halloween ready to play in an NFL game with having
zero practices with the team all offseason zero preseason showings does not know the system
has not worked with the coaches does not know the players tendencies so he would show up and
there would be this onboarding period of about weeks I I would say and granted reick is a good
pass rusher he's a veteran pass rusher you can line him up wide outside and just say go attack
the quarterback um you know use your moves use your you know bag of tricks to blow by tackles and
and get in the back field but as far as reic just being like that starter playing whatever it may
be 65 70% of the snaps you know you're not just going to sign him tonight and he's going to step
into that role by the next game the third option reic just skips the whole year and it continues to
be a distraction week after week after week month after month and that's that's it right we gave
up a sweet pick reic never shows up and that's the end of it right and it it just looks weird and
and again it's a talking point every single week and it gets magnified every week that the Jets
pass rush doesn't have success and then option number four the Jets trade reic I I know Douglas
